色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

mysql按順序填補空缺

錢多多2年前11瀏覽0評論

MySQL是一種廣泛使用的關系型數據庫管理系統。在MySQL中,我們可以使用INSERT命令將數據插入到表中。然而,如果我們忘記了某些列或者不需要填充某些列的數據,MySQL將會拋出錯誤并終止操作。本文將介紹如何填補mysql中的空缺,以便我們的插入操作順利進行。

如果我們需要插入一條數據,但不需要填充某些列,可以使用以下語法:
INSERT INTO table_name (column1, column2, column3, ...)
VALUES (value1, value2, DEFAULT, ...);
其中DEFAULT關鍵字用于表示該列的默認值,這樣我們就可以成功插入數據,同時保持其他列的默認值不變。
如果我們想要在INSERT語句中跳過某一列,可以使用以下語法:
INSERT INTO table_name (column1, column3, ...)
VALUES (value1, value3, ...);
這里我們只填充了column1和column3,其他列將被自動填充為其默認值。
如果我們想要在INSERT語句中填充某些列的NULL值,可以使用以下語法:
INSERT INTO table_name (column1, column2, column3, ...)
VALUES (value1, NULL, value3, ...);
這里,我們將column2設置為NULL,其他列將被自動填充為其默認值。
最后,如果我們想要在INSERT語句中填充一個空字符串,可以使用以下語法:
INSERT INTO table_name (column1, column2, column3, ...)
VALUES (value1, '', value3, ...);
這里,我們將column2設置為空字符串,其他列將被自動填充為其默認值。
使用以上幾種語法,我們可以解決MySQL中常見的空缺填補問題,確保INSERT語句的順利進行。